Transaction e89c07b7d043c937b58b249abd3ac38abb9bf01601efccc975776db59cd3c486
1 Input
1 Output
-
e89c07b7d043c937b58b249abd3ac38abb9bf01601efccc975776db59cd3c486:0
- value
- 74793
- script pubkey
- OP_0 OP_PUSHBYTES_20 68d50beb81a3c0592adbb1a2340485524417071f
- address
- bc1qdr2sh6up50q9j2kmkx3rgpy92fzpwpclklx3we